Apr 2023 – PresentFull-time
Software Development Engineer
Hobby Lobby — Museum of the Bible Team
  • Architect and maintain cross-platform Flutter/Dart mobile application for the Museum of the Bible (MOTB), serving iOS and Android users across global audiences
  • Reduced load times by 30% through Dart performance profiling, memory optimization, and systematic code refactoring using Android Studio and Xcode
  • Increased user satisfaction by 25% and engagement by 15% through responsive widget-based UI design and performance-first component architecture
  • Lead peer code reviews in Git, enforce clean architecture and testing standards, and mentor engineers — maintaining a scalable, low-technical-debt codebase
  • Coordinated end-to-end feature delivery: scoping, building, testing, and deploying across product, design, and QA teams in Agile/Scrum sprints via Jira
  • Implemented in-app analytics tracking across iOS and Android to monitor engagement funnels and inform data-driven product decisions

Aug 2019 – Aug 2022Startup
Software Engineer
WhoFi
  • Built and maintained full-stack web and analytics apps serving 200+ enterprise locations using PHP, JavaScript, C#, and SQL — engineered complete system from data ingestion to client-facing dashboards
  • Built Disconnect Email Alert system for 200+ library locations (PHP, JavaScript) — increased operational efficiency by 20% through real-time patron notifications
  • Developed foot traffic analytics dashboard enabling retail clients to optimize store hours, contributing to a 7% increase in client sales
  • Built C#/.NET plugins integrating Aruba SNMP V3, DHCP, and Ruckus SmartCell Insights across 40+ enterprise branches — improved data pipeline accuracy by 17%
  • Eliminated manual reporting overhead by automating 150+ on-demand and scheduled SQL reports, enabling data-driven client decisions at scale
  • Implemented serverless event-driven data workflows using AWS Lambda and S3 alongside Microsoft Azure deployments
  • Cut device onboarding time by 50% using Android (Java/Kotlin) and iOS (Swift) diagnostic tools; managed distributed infrastructure on Microsoft Azure
  • Owned end-to-end feature delivery: scoping, building, testing, and deploying — operating across multiple concurrent workstreams in a fast-moving startup environment
